Play gives White Supremacy the Smackdown This fall, don’t miss Will You Be My Friend produced by Waterloo Region’s Green Light Arts, with the support of Theatre Passe Muraille.
Dr. West, Pluto's leading Friendiologist, presents a program just for People of Colour (POC) to make friends and find happiness. His secret: become White! Janice, a lonely artist, enthusiastically enrolls and gets paired up with Mike. He's a super well-meaning guy. Observe as she navigates love, friendship and the fun times pretending not to be "ethnic."
Originally titled: Janice Lee and the White Supremacy Smackdown, Will You Be My Friend is a sharply funny and brutally honest musical comedy about the everyday challenges when loving white people. Written by and starring award-winning Korean-Canadian artist, Janice Jo Lee. Through stories and fifteen original songs the award-winning performer challenges audiences to examine their privileges and reconsider the different ways we act in day-to-day life.
After premiering in Kitchener, ON to sold-out houses, Green Light Arts is bringing their hit show to Theatre Passe Muraille Backspace from Oct 25-Nov 11, 2018, thanks to the support of Theatre Passe Muraille who programmed it in their 2018-19 Season. “I am always interested in programming shows where people use their own lived experience as a jumping off point for dramatizing larger issues that are resonant and relevant to all of us. It also helps if it's as funny as this is. Plus it is a bonus for us to present the work of someone who doesn’t live in Toronto. And on top of all of that there’s music. What’s not to love?” offers Andy McKim, Theatre Passe Muraille’s Artistic Director.
Laura Mae Lindo, MPP for Kitchener Centre and a super supporter of the show, exclaimed that the play is the “perfect way to unpack racism, shed labels of ‘multiculturalism’ and ‘diversity’, and create a space where true work on anti-oppression can begin allowing for a much more nuanced and authentic discussion to occur.”
“The play is unapologetic,” shares Green Light Arts, Artistic Producer, Matt White who directed and helped develop the show with Janice. “When I first approached her about working together,” Matt continues, “she told me about this but warned me that, as a white man, I am kind of the antagonist in the play. I was up for the challenge. It’s been a great journey. I’ve learned a lot about privilege and the nuances of allyship. There is a definite urgency to having these conversations.”
Despite having been developing for a couple of years, the play contains themes headlining news feeds across North America. Sometimes it can feel like nothing is changing in these narratives. It is really refreshing when Janice disrupts the arc of the play: “we use the structure of the kind of a romantic musical fairy tale and then flip it on its head to challenge the audience to recognize that we can’t just laugh at the racism built into the structure, and go home feeling good and move on,” Janice suggests, “if they are aware of how easy it is to get away with racism, maybe they can do or say something to stop the behaviour.”
